POSHAN – CAPITAL DEEPENING

Capital deepening is a situation where the capital per worker is increasing in the economy . This is also referred to as increase in the capital intensity. Capital deepening is often measured by the rate of change in capital stock per labor hour. Overall, the economy will expand, and productivity per worker will increase. Third, internet growth will also lead to massive job creation. About 4 lakh people now find direct employment because of the internet. This will expand to 20 lakh by 2020, BCG estimates. 211

Second, it could catalyze entrepreneurship and wealth creation. Global investors are already chasing Indian startups.

2010

First, internet growth could spawn an economy worth $200 billion from internet related activities, according to Boston Consulting Group (BCG).

URJA - NET KRANTI A digital population of 500 million could transform India's economy, business landscape, governance and society beyond recognition.

Fourth, India's internet economy could eventually create 65 million jobs and increase per capita income by 29% as more people come online, according to a Deloitte Consulting report titled 'Value of Connectivity.'
